DroidTV MX with Android 4.2.2 and XBMC

Yup, I have one at home, it is great. Streams HD movies without any issues. Be aware that the current stock firmware only does 720p, but this is universal to pretty much all Android media players. There is a linux firmware build for this device which can apparently do 1080p.

It means the device can decode 1080p video but only outputs it at 720p.

Be aware that there are MANY clones of this device. The DroidTV MX itself is sort of a clone, but it comes preloaded with firmware from a G-Box Midnight MX2. The MX2 is made by a company that is western, so the firmware is a lot better. Hence, the DroidTV MX firmware is pretty decent since it is in fact the MX2 firmware. Its pretty stable.
